Hi,

You can load your Para as passengers during a campaign, if you meet one of the following conditions:

1. Trasport recruited as support AUX unit before deployment phase,
2. Transport assigned as AUX unit from scenario designer,
3. Transport included in core force (if you decide to use it during a scenario then you must fix it at the replacement phase - fix damage of 1 - in order to be able to use it at the next scenario)

exception:
If the scenario designer makes the Transport unit a FIX (Aux) unit, then the player may not use (load) it.

Even if you plot the drop zones for the AUX transport in the editor (for a specific campaign scenario) the player during the deployment phase may change at no cost the drop zone to one of his choice.
The best thing to do in such case is to write in the description of the scenario that the player should respect and leave unmodified the pre-selected drop-zones.
I am sure that any player who wish to enjoy a well balanced scenario will respect that notice!

Hi,

The only way to have them on scenario No#1 is either as core force or as recruited support units (if the flight availability permits it **flights>0).

In any other scenario you may additionally assign them as pre-selected (already included in the scenario) assets, either as AUX or as FIX units.
The only difference is that if you set them as FIX units then you may also load them with AUX paratroopers and fixing that way that the combination paratrooper-transport will be respected. You may also assign the pre-determined drop zone, but you must notify the player that he must not modify the drop zone target (because during his deployment phase he may do so).

Not really. What I do for my campaigns IS make the 1st scenario a VERY small one. I consider it an orientation scenario, You get a small map with a mission such as move your unit to a designated assembly area and set up a perimeter. I do not purchase any enemy units (just the HQ). I edit its move to '0' and hide it in a far off corner so it doesn't get involved in a fight. Keep the scenario to 4-7 turns so its quick. This helps bypass the 1st scenario restrictions on AUX units (since the 2nd scenario is really the actual 'Start' of the campaign) and helps the player get acclimated to his units without having to worry about losing men while he is getting adjusted to the force structure.
